No. 1 Star: Teddy Purcell, Edmonton Oilers 

Purcell had two goals in the first period just 1:44 apart and then assisted on Justin Schultz’s goal as the Edmonton Oilers defeated the Winnipeg Jets, 3-1.

No. 2 Star: Antti Niemi, Dallas Stars

Kari Lehtonen started for the Stars, and gave up two goals on four shots in 8:16. Niemi came on and stopped 30 of 31 shots to help the Stars rally for a 6-3 win over the Minnesota Wild. Tyler Seguin scored his 19th. Vernon Fiddler had two goals.

No. 3 Star: Tyler Bozak, Toronto Maple Leafs

Bozak notched a hat trick (including an empty netter) as the Toronto Maple Leafs routed the Colorado Avalanche. 7-4. Jake Gardiner had four points, while James van Riemsdyk and Leo Komorov had three points.

Honorable Mention: Phil Kessel was one of the players coach Mike Sullivan challenged to be better, and he responded with two goals just under 12 minutes apart in the second period to lead the Penguins to a 5-2 win over the Columbus Blue Jackets. Evgeni Malkin also had two goals. … Wayne Simmonds scored a critical second period goal to continue a Flyers’ rally from a 3-0 hole, and then tied the game on the power play 51 seconds into the third period. Evgeny Medvedev would give the Flyers the impressive 4-3 comeback over the St. Louis Blues. … Jack Skille had two goals for the Avs. … Josh Bailey and Matt Martin scored in the third period to put away the Anaheim Ducks, as the New York Islanders topped them 5-2. … Phillipp Grubauer made 31 saves and the Washington Capitals defeated the Carolina Hurricanes, 2-1. … Roman Josi and Shea Weber opened the scoring and Pekka Rinne didn’t look back with 35 saves in the Nashville Predators’ 5-1 win over the Montreal Canadiens.

Did You Know? Philadelphia is 8-2-2 in its past 12 games and has moved within two points of the Ottawa Senators for the second wild-card spot

Dishonorable Mention: Cam Fowler and Shawn Horcoff were a minus-3. … Freddie Andersen was pulled after giving up three goals on 11 shots. … David Backes was a minus-3. … Dalton Prout when cross-check crazy on Sergei Plotnikov.Boone Jenner went knee-on-knee with Malkin. … Montreal has lost eight of its past nine games. … Mikko Koivu, Zach Parise, Thomas Vanek and Jason Pominville were a minus-3.
